The station has several user-friendly amenities to make your journey more comfortable. Although there's no ticket office, ticket machines are conveniently available for collecting tickets. It's easy to collect tickets bought online as the machines are straightforward to use—ensuring a seamless start to your travel. For those who need auditory assistance, the station is equipped with an induction loop system, greatly aiding those with hearing impairments. However, note that there are no accessible ticket machines, so make any necessary arrangements in advance.
The station lacks some of the more luxurious facilities such as waiting rooms, refreshment outlets, and shops, but it compensates with practicality. While it might not be the spot for a leisurely hangout, it ticks the boxes for essential travel needs. CCTV presence provides an added layer of security, reassuring passengers of their safety during their transit. Plus, if you ever find yourself lost or in need of help, customer help points are scattered around to guide you.
Getting to your destination is made easier with several transport links available. For those relying on buses, Witton boasts a rearranged bus stop due to the road closure on Electric Avenue. Visitors can catch their services from Aston Lane, conveniently positioned near local landmarks like Tesco. Taxi services are also at your disposal, with reliable operators like Alpha, Midland, and Nationwide ready to whisk you away. Though cycling enthusiasts won't find bicycle storage or hire facilities, the comprehensive public transport options make up for it.
In cases where rail replacement services come into play, these will operate from the bus stop on Witton Road, conveniently situated under the bridge and at the bottom of the ramp. Just be sure to verify your destination to ensure a smooth connection.

Penyffordd station is a charming spot, characterized by its simplicity. The station does not have a ticket office or machines, so travelers are recommended to purchase tickets online or via mobile for convenience. What it lacks in commercial facilities such as shops and ATMs, Penyffordd makes up for with its accessibility features. Highlights include step-free access to both platforms through ramps and gates, making traveling a bit easier for those with mobility needs. Moreover, an induction loop is available for hearing aid users.
Despite the absence of CCTV, public Wi-Fi, and other typical amenities, the calm environment is perfect for those who enjoy an uncomplicated travel experience. For any queries or assistance, passengers can reach out to the customer relations team at Transport for Wales via their website. Additionally, there's a helpline available to reassure travelers needing extra support or guidance during their journey.
Getting around from Penyffordd station is straightforward thanks to local bus services readily available nearby. The bus stops are conveniently located in the village center outside the Red Lion Pub, providing straightforward access to different parts of the area. Although bicycle hire is not available at the station itself, cyclists can find dedicated bicycle parking in the station car park, facilitating an easy blend of traveling by train and cycling.
For those times when rail replacement services are necessary, travelers will find the bus stop for such services within the station car park. This coordination helps ensure that onward journeys are as smooth as possible during disruptions.
